- Scope and content:
-
Drawings and sketches, with a few photographs and copies, for approximately 15 projects, most in the Santa Barbara and Ojai areas. A few drawings were made for commissions in Orange County, California. The drawings illustrate Mahan's drawing skill and commitment to the Spanish Colonial style that characterizes the Santa Barbara region.
